Johannesburg
London
BEST
DEAL

Sat, 07 Jun
JNB - LHR
R5976
R5722
Prime price per passenger
Johannesburg
London
BEST
DEAL

Thu, 03 Apr
JNB - LHR

Mon, 07 Apr
LHR - JNB
R15475
R14849
Prime price per passenger
Johannesburg
London
BEST
DEAL

Thu, 03 Apr
JNB - LHR

Mon, 07 Apr
LHR - JNB
R15539
R14913
Prime price per passenger